引言

区块链钱包是一种用于存储和管理数字资产的工具。它采用了区块链技术的原理,确保了数字资产的安全性、隐私性和不可篡改性。本文将详细介绍区块链钱包的工作原理,包括密钥对生成、数字签名、交易广播以及分布式账本的特点和优势。

1. 区块链钱包的密钥对生成

区块链钱包基于非对称加密算法生成公钥和私钥的密钥对。私钥被保密存储在用户的钱包中,而公钥则作为用户的地址在区块链上公开展示。私钥和公钥之间是一对一的关系,私钥可以生成唯一的公钥,但公钥无法逆向推导出私钥。这种机制确保了用户的资产安全,只有持有正确的私钥才能对资产进行操作。

2. 数字签名

在区块链中,用户使用私钥对交易进行数字签名。数字签名是一种在区块链中验证交易真实性和完整性的机制。当用户创建一笔交易时,他们使用私钥对交易进行签名,将签名附加到交易数据中。其他用户在接收到该交易后,可以使用发送方的公钥对签名进行验证,以确保交易是由合法的发送方创建的,并且交易数据没有被篡改。这种机制使得交易在区块链上是可信的和不可篡改的。

3. 交易广播

区块链钱包在发起交易后,需要将交易信息广播到整个网络中,以便其他节点验证和记录交易。交易广播的过程是通过节点之间的点对点通信实现的。当一个节点接收到一笔交易后,它会验证交易的合法性,并将交易转发给其他节点。其他节点再次验证交易的合法性,并将其记录在自己的区块链账本中。通过广播和验证的过程,区块链中的每一笔交易都可以被所有节点确认和记录,确保了交易的安全性和一致性。

4. 分布式账本的特点和优势

区块链钱包中存储的数字资产信息是分布式存储在整个区块链网络中的。每个节点都有完整的账本副本,共同参与验证和记录交易。这种分布式账本的特点和优势包括:

a) 去中心化

区块链钱包的账本不依赖于中心化的机构或服务器存储,而是由网络中的节点共同维护。这种去中心化的特点使得区块链钱包具有更高的安全性和抗攻击性。

b) 可追溯性

由于区块链中的所有交易都被记录在账本中,每一笔交易都可以追溯到其发起方和接收方。这种可追溯性可以增加交易的透明度和可信度。

c) 可靠性

区块链中的账本副本分布在多个节点上,即使某些节点出现故障或恶意行为,其他节点仍然可以继续验证和记录交易。这种分布式存储机制确保了账本的可靠性和稳定性。

d) 高度安全性

区块链钱包的安全性主要依赖于非对称加密算法和分布式账本的共识机制。私钥的保密性和数字签名的验证机制保证了用户资产的安全性,而分布式账本的共识机制使得篡改账本变得非常困难。

相关问题

如何选择一个安全可靠的区块链钱包?

在选择区块链钱包时,用户应该考虑以下几个因素:钱包的安全性、用户体验、支持的加密货币种类、团队背景和声誉等。本问题详细介绍如何选择一个安全可靠的区块链钱包。

如何备份和恢复区块链钱包?

用户在使用区块链钱包时必须注意备份私钥和恢复钱包的方法。本问题将介绍几种常见的备份和恢复钱包的方法,以及如何确保私钥的安全性。

区块链钱包的助记词是什么?如何使用助记词恢复钱包?

助记词是一种以单词形式表示的私钥的备份和恢复方式。本问题将详细介绍助记词的原理和使用方法,并给出一些助记词的安全管理建议。

如何确保区块链钱包的安全性?

区块链钱包的安全性是用户非常关注的问题。本问题将提供一些建议和措施,以确保区块链钱包的安全性,包括密码的设置、多重签名的使用和防范钓鱼攻击等。 以上就是区块链钱包的原理和相关问题的详细介绍。区块链钱包作为数字资产存储和管理的关键工具,具有高度的安全性和可靠性,为用户提供了便捷的数字资产交易和管理体验。